Most civics & integras have holes already drilled for that bar in the proper location. They should be pluged with rubber grometts that are painted the same color as the car. If you do not have the grometts & holes, your going to have to drill. To find the correct spot, I've heard that the proper location for the holes can be located by looking up into the fender (above the upper control arm). The shock tower is constructed of two metal panels welded together. I've heard that the bottom layer should always have the holes (this is hear-say though ). Then all you do is drill up through them into the engine bay (keep wires away ).
Oh yeah, your going to need 4 short grade 10.2 metric bolts, matching nylon lock nuts, and 8 washers
